10 Enter into the rock,
    and hide in the dust,
from before the terror of Yahweh,
    and from the glory of his majesty.
11 The lofty looks of man will be brought low,
    the arrogance of men will be bowed down,
    and Yahweh alone will be exalted in that day.

12 For there will be a day of Yahweh of Armies for all that is proud and arrogant,
    and for all that is lifted up;
    and it shall be brought low:
13     for all the cedars of Lebanon, that are high and lifted up,
    for all the oaks of Bashan,
14     for all the high mountains,
    for all the hills that are lifted up,
15     for every lofty tower,
    for every fortified wall,
16     for all the ships of Tarshish,
    and for all pleasant imagery.
17 The loftiness of man shall be bowed down,
    and the arrogance of men shall be brought low;
    and Yahweh alone shall be exalted in that day.

10 (A)Enter into the rock, and hide in the dust,
From the terror of the Lord
And the glory of His majesty.
11 The [a]lofty looks of man shall be (B)humbled,
The haughtiness of men shall be bowed down,
And the Lord alone shall be exalted (C)in that day.

12 For the day of the Lord of hosts
Shall come upon everything proud and lofty,
Upon everything lifted up—
And it shall be brought low—
13 Upon all (D)the cedars of Lebanon that are high and lifted up,
And upon all the oaks of Bashan;
14 (E)Upon all the high mountains,
And upon all the hills that are lifted up;
15 Upon every high tower,
And upon every fortified wall;
16 (F)Upon all the ships of Tarshish,
And upon all the beautiful sloops.
17 The [b]loftiness of man shall be bowed down,
And the haughtiness of men shall be brought low;
The Lord alone will be exalted in that day,
